RootWave Pro User Guide
4. Insert the Treatment Return and
Safety Earth into the ground
To install the Treatment Return:
Do not yet connect the Long
Treatment Cable, the Short
Treatment Cable and the Treatment
Return. Instead, lay them out on dry
ground.
Remove any vegetation from
Treatment Return site as the
Treatment Return should sit directly onto soil surface.
Gripping the Treatment Return Blade firmly in one hand place the
sharp end on the soil surface and use the rubber mallet to drive it
into the ground until it is submerged with the top level with the
soil surface.
Do not prepare the ground for the Treatment Return Blade by
making a hole or incision into which you insert the blade. The
Blade needs pressure from the soil over its entire surface to
ensure good electrical contact is made to minimise underground
arcing which can lead to accelerated heating. Forcing the blade
into unprepared ground with the mallet ensures this.
Take the Treatment Return, position it over the Treatment Return
Blade lining up the threaded spigot with the threaded hole, then
lower the Treatment Return onto the Treatment Return Blade.
Screw the Treatment Return firmly in a clockwise direction onto
the Treatment Return Blade until it comes to a stop.
Once the Treatment Return has been full assembled onto the
Treatment Return Blade the cables can then be connected to the
Treatment Return.
If the rubber mallet becomes damaged replacements are
available from your RootWave Pro supplier.
